Material Selection
We offer a variety of flat roofing materials, including:
- TPO (Thermoplastic Olefin): A durable and energy-efficient option with excellent UV resistance.
- P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ride): Known for its long lifespan and resistance to chemicals and punctures.
- Modified Bitumen: A cost-effective and reliable option with good waterproofing properties.

Water Ponding
The Problem: Water ponding, or standing water, is one of the most common problems with flat roofs. Because these roofs have little to no slope, water can accumulate after rain or snow, rather than draining off. This can lead to added weight on the roof, potentially causing structural stress. Over time, standing water can also seep into the roofing material, leading to leaks, mold growth, and deterioration of the roof structure.
Why It Matters: If left unaddressed, water ponding can severely compromise the integrity of your roof, resulting in costly repairs and potentially impacting the safety of the building or home. It can also lead to decreased energy efficiency, as the moisture can affect insulation and increase cooling costs during hot Texas summers.
Our Solution: At Allen Roofing Pros, we employ precise grading techniques during installation to ensure proper drainage right from the start. For existing roofs suffering from ponding, we offer solutions like installing tapered insulation systems to create a slight slope, enhancing drainage and preventing water accumulation.
Seam Weakness and Leaks
The Problem: Flat roofs often consist of multiple sheets of roofing material, joined at seams. These seams can be vulnerable to weather exposure, temperature variations, and physical wear, leading to weakening and eventual leaks. In Allen, TX, the hot summers and occasional severe storms can exacerbate seam issues, causing materials to expand and contract, contributing to seam failure.
Why It Matters: Leaks can lead to a host of interior issues, including water damage to walls and ceilings, electrical problems, and the development of harmful mold. Detecting leaks early and addressing seam weaknesses are crucial for preventing extensive damage and maintaining a healthy indoor environment.

UV Degradation
The Problem: The Texas sun can be relentless, and flat roofs are directly exposed to harsh ultraviolet (UV) rays. Over time, UV radiation can degrade roofing materials, causing them to become brittle and lose their protective qualities. This degradation can lead to cracking, shrinking, and reduced performance of the roofing membrane.
Why It Matters: UV degradation not only affects the appearance of your roof but also significantly shortens its lifespan. As the roof material deteriorates, it becomes more vulnerable to leaks and other forms of damage, increasing the need for repairs or complete roof replacement.
Our Solution: We utilize roofing materials that are specifically designed to resist UV degradation. Additionally, we can apply reflective roof coatings that bounce back UV rays, helping to extend the life of your flat roof and reduce cooling costs by keeping the building cooler.
Inadequate Insulation and Ventilation
The Problem: Proper insulation and ventilation are crucial for managing temperature and moisture levels under a flat roof. Without adequate insulation, buildings can experience significant heat gain in the summer and heat loss in the winter, leading to higher energy bills. Poor ventilation can trap moisture, creating a breeding ground for mold and causing wood rot, corroding underlayments needing roof cleaning more frequently.
Why It Matters: Insufficient insulation and ventilation can lead to increased energy costs, structural damage, health risks from mold, and a less comfortable indoor environment. These issues can affect not only the buildings occupants but also its resale value.

Signs You Need Flat Roof Repair or Replacement
Recognizing early warning signs of flat roof issues can save you time, money, and stress. Here are some indicators that may suggest your flat roof needs professional attention:
- Visible Leaks: Water stains on ceilings or walls are a clear sign of a roof leak.
- Standing Water: Persistent ponding of water on the roof surface.
- Blistering or Bubbling: Raised areas on the roof membrane indicate trapped moisture.
- Cracks or Tears: Visible damage to the roofing material.
- Increased Energy Bills: Higher than usual utility costs may indicate insulation issues.

Frequently Asked Questions About Flat Roofs
Here are some common questions we receive about flat roofs:
- How long does a flat roof last? The lifespan of a flat roof depends on the material and maintenance, but typically ranges from 10 to 20 years.
- Are flat roofs more prone to leaks? Flat roofs can be more susceptible to leaks if not properly installed and maintained.
- How much does a flat roof cost? The cost varies depending on the material and size of the roof but is often comparable to other roofing systems.
- Can I walk on my flat roof? It depends on the roofing material. Some flat roofs are designed for foot traffic, while others are not.
